  5. B

    Brian's Sovereign of the seas

    She is a early ship ( 1637) before copper was used, she has a white painted hull below the waterline (a protective anti-fouling mixture containing calcium carbonate (lime) to protect the wooden hull from shipworms and marine rot.)
